  • Publication number: 20230305758
    Abstract: According to a magnetic disk apparatus of one embodiment, threshold voltages of memory cell transistors of a flash memory are set to a first section for a first value or to a second section for a second value. The second section is on a lower voltage side than the first section. The controller performs bit inversion of second data held in a volatile memory and writes the second data onto the flash memory when a power loss occurs while the second data corresponds to third data in which a number of the first values is larger than that of the second values. The controller writes the second data onto the flash memory without bit inversion when a power loss occurs while the second data corresponds to fourth data. The fourth data is data in which a number of the first values is smaller than that of the second values.

  • Publication number: 20190286208
    Abstract: According to an embodiment, a controller of a disc device writes data received from a host device to a disc via a cache area while power from an external power supply is supplied. In a case in which supply of the power from the external power supply is cut off, the controller saves content of a cache area in a nonvolatile memory using regenerative energy generated in a motor that rotates the disc. The controller increases or decreases a size of the cache area based on a temperature detected by a temperature sensor and a writing rate of the nonvolatile memory while the power from the external power supply is supplied.

  • Publication number: 20170024297
    Abstract: A storage device according to the present embodiment is connected to a host device and includes a controller. The controller stores data from the host device in a non-volatile storage unit after storing the data in a cache memory. The controller backs up the data in the cache memory onto a non-volatile memory using an auxiliary power source when power loss occurs. Furthermore, the controller adjusts the set size of the cache memory based on the device temperature near the storage device and the writing speed at which data is written to the non-volatile memory.

  • Patent number: 8478918
    Abstract: According to one embodiment, an interface comprises establishing a connection to a communicatee device, transmitting a connection maintenance signal to the communicatee device, and decreasing a maximum amplitude of the connection maintenance signal from a first amplitude, establishing a connection to the communicatee device again when communication is disabled, and transmitting the connection maintenance signal to the communicatee device, and setting the maximum amplitude of the connection maintenance signal to a second amplitude which is larger than the maximum value of the connection maintenance signal obtained when the communication is disabled by a predetermined value.

  • Publication number: 20120219049
    Abstract: One embodiment provides a signal reception apparatus including: a reception module configured to receive a signal; a storing module configured to store information regarding a characteristic of the received signal; a determination module configured to read out the stored information and to determine a parameter value corresponding to the read-out information; a discrimination module configured to discriminate a noise contained in the signal, based on the signal and the determined parameter value; and an identification module configured to identify the noise contained in the signal, based on a discrimination result by the discrimination module.
